Utilising their vineyard and state-of-the-art winery located in Tuerong, Yabby Lake has established an enviable reputation for producing some of the finest wines on Victoria's Mornington Peninsula. Led by the highly credentialed winemaker Tom Carson, Yabby Lake's philosophy is to craft wines that speak of their unique site and are reflective of the season in which they were grown.
The 2025 Yabby Lake Single Vineyard Pinot Noir is a masterful reflection of the Mornington Peninsula’s cool-climate elegance. This vintage bursts with fragrant aromas of bright red cherry, wild strawberry, and subtle floral lift. The palate is characterised by incredible purity and silkiness, underpinned by fine-grained tannins and a characteristic mineral backbone. It is a precise, sophisticated wine that captures the unique personality of the vineyard with exceptional length and poise.
"96 Points. Tasted soon after bottling, although it’s headed to market quickly, but more time in bottle will help to build depth. Don’t get me wrong, it’s very good. I like it a lot, thanks to its wave of richness, an amalgam of dark cherries, charcuterie, woodsy spices, some blood orange and a whiff of autumn. It's fuller bodied, with more sweet fruit caressing across the palate and meeting up with plush, supple tannins. Refreshing acidity to close."- Jane Faulkner, Halliday Wine Companion.
